ID-10024302Christians are being terrorized everywhere! In the Middle East, especially in Syria, believers are threatened with abuse, both physically and spiritually, even to the point of death. In countries in Africa, especially in parts where there is Islamic extremism, Christ’s followers are being beaten, churches burned or driven from their homes. In America, the church is under fire from outside forces challenging traditional and i dare say, moral values. It is also under threat from within where just recently, churches are being divided on their respective stance on homosexuality and same-sex marriage. And lastly, we are terrorized individually by forces that is obviously spiritual in nature.

The question now posed to Bible believing and God fearing people is, will we be terrorized?

I will attempt to answer this question in the context of the beleaguered believer whose warfare  is not “….against flesh-and-blood enemies, but against evil rulers and authorities of the unseen world, against mighty powers in this dark world, and against evil spirits in the heavenly places.” (Ephesians 6:12, NLT)

Christ’s followers are spiritual people. Therefore we will definitely be terrorized by our spiritual enemy, the devil. It is not a question of how but when. How we handle this kind of terrorism depends on how we believe God and I tell you, the devil will test AND terrorize you. There is a season for these kinds of things. You may be prosperous and healthy for a long time and then the season of testing comes. These testings can bring terror to the hearts of the unprepared.

Again, will you allow yourself to be terrorized by the devil? Yes, we cannot stop him from doing so. How you respond will define your faith in God.

By the way, it’s normal to be scared and feel terror. That’s our fallen nature. But if we believe that Jesus came that we may have life and have it more abundantly (John 10:10) and that “…you did not receive the spirit of bondage again to fear, but you received the Spirit of adoption by whom we cry out, ‘Abba, Father.'” Romans 8:15

When the devil terrorize us with disease, unemployment, debt, or loss of loved ones, our response should not be cowering in fear. What we need to do is run to God. You and I WILL be scared but if we trust and believe that God as our Father, will protect His children as He promised. That “…all things work together for good to those who love God, to those who are the called according to His purpose.” (Romans 8:28, NKJV)

Do you love God? Then all you need to do when the devil terrorizes you is to stand your ground…and believe.
